GENERATING A PULSE-WIDTH MODULATED SIGNAL BY MEANS OF TIMER MODULE INTERRUPT OF PIC18F2550 MCU

Journal Title: Aerospace Research in Bulgaria - Year 2017, Vol 29, Issue

Abstract

The article hereby examines an approach towards pulse-width modulated (PWM) signal generation by means of PIC18F2550 microcontroller unit (MCU). The proposed technique employs the so-called internal interrupt by timer module. This solution may come into use in process automation as a terminal device, for instance putting in motion a servo motor. Although the MCU provides a hardware PWM module, it is dependant of the crystal oscillator frequency. Most of the time, it is difficult to generate a PWM signal at low frequencies. The proposed solution is shown to be versatile enough and suitable to actuate servomotors widely used in RC hobby activities. Special attention is given to the MCU software peculiarities. Additional computer simulation has also been made. The used software was MikroC Pro for PIC and Proteus VMS. The proposed solution has been shown to operate with sufficient precision. The source code is also included in the present article.
